Output d8e88346839a883e60a8dc4a1793716e40c957ddcd31151afa871ffcf2916f7b:0

value
38000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e7f3d98ce736372bfe4c24448205529514a7b26 OP_EQUAL
address
331fp4ZLZu77L9fqhoezMgx4xgYrSD1jCE
transaction
d8e88346839a883e60a8dc4a1793716e40c957ddcd31151afa871ffcf2916f7b
confirmations
253112
spent
true